Cirrus Logic, Inc. $CRUS Shares Acquired by Ritholtz Wealth Management

Ritholtz Wealth Management grew its holdings in Cirrus Logic, Inc. (NASDAQ:CRUSFree Report) by 7.8% during the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 6,680 shares of the semiconductor company’s stock after purchasing an additional 486 shares during the quarter. Ritholtz Wealth Management’s holdings in Cirrus Logic were worth $696,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Insider Buying and Selling at Cirrus Logic

In other Cirrus Logic news, EVP Scott Thomas sold 11,089 shares of Cirrus Logic stock in a transaction on Thursday, September 18th. The shares were sold at an average price of $121.49, for a total value of $1,347,202.61. Following the transaction, the executive vice president owned 26,307 shares in the company, valued at $3,196,037.43. This trade represents a 29.65%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available through this link. Also, EVP Denise Grode sold 2,202 shares of Cirrus Logic stock in a transaction on Monday, September 15th. The shares were sold at an average price of $116.87, for a total transaction of $257,347.74. Following the completion of the transaction, the executive vice president owned 5,698 shares in the company, valued at approximately $665,925.26. This trade represents a 27.87% decrease in their position. The disclosure for this sale can be found here. Insiders have sold a total of 32,453 shares of company stock worth $3,821,790 in the last quarter. 1.16% of the stock is owned by insiders.

Cirrus Logic Stock Up 2.4%

Shares of CRUS opened at $126.15 on Friday. The firm has a market cap of $6.48 billion, a PE ratio of 19.74 and a beta of 1.09. The company’s fifty day moving average is $118.77 and its two-hundred day moving average is $106.22. Cirrus Logic, Inc. has a fifty-two week low of $75.83 and a fifty-two week high of $129.56.

Cirrus Logic (NASDAQ:CRUSG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, August 5th. The semiconductor company reported $1.51 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.07 by $0.44. The company had revenue of $407.27 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$361.97 million. Cirrus Logic had a net margin of 18.15% and a return on equity of 18.38%. Cirrus Logic’s revenue for the quarter was up 8.9%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$1.12 EPS. Cirrus Logic has set its Q2 2026 guidance at EPS. As a group, equities research analysts anticipate that Cirrus Logic, Inc. will post 5.63 earnings per share for the current year.

About Cirrus Logic

(Free Report)

Cirrus Logic, Inc, a fabless semiconductor company, develops low-power high-precision mixed-signal processing solutions in China, the United States, and internationally. The company offers audio products, including amplifiers; codecs components that integrate analog-to-digital converters (ADCs) and digital-to-analog converters (DACs) into a single integrated circuit (IC); smart codecs, a codec with integrated digital signal processing; standalone digital signal processors; and SoundClear technology, which consists of a portfolio of tools, software, and algorithms that helps to enhance user experience with features, such as louder, high-fidelity sound, audio playback, voice capture, and hearing augmentation for use in smartphones, tablets, laptops, AR/VR headsets, home theater systems, automotive entertainment systems, and professional audio systems.
